diff options
| author | NIIBE Yutaka <[email protected]> | 2013-08-30 02:06:50 +0000 |
|---|---|---|
| committer | NIIBE Yutaka <[email protected]> | 2013-08-30 02:06:50 +0000 |
| commit | 95a3bffeaf07e8bf9487d4b165c336d166236fc1 (patch) | |
| tree | 85c1d19be8b48b4a377931b8514adaddcdf58da7 /g10/mainproc.c | |
| parent | scd: add support for RSA_CRT and RSA_CRT_N key import. (diff) | |
| download | gnupg-95a3bffeaf07e8bf9487d4b165c336d166236fc1.tar.gz gnupg-95a3bffeaf07e8bf9487d4b165c336d166236fc1.zip | |
scd: PC/SC pinpad input improvement.
* scd/apdu.c (struct reader_table_s): Add members: PINMIN, PINMAX, and
PINPAD_VERLEN_SUPPORTED.
(CM_IOCTL_VENDOR_IFD_EXCHANGE, FEATURE_GET_TLV_PROPERTIES,
PCSCv2_PART10_PROPERTY_*): New.
(new_reader_slot): Initialize pinpad_varlen_supported, pinmin, pinmax.
(pcsc_vendor_specific_init): New.
(open_pcsc_reader_direct, open_pcsc_reader_wrapped): Call
pcsc_vendor_specific_init.
(check_pcsc_pinpad): Not detect here but use the result of
pcsc_vendor_specific_init.
(pcsc_pinpad_verify, pcsc_pinpad_modify): Specify bNumberMessage.
--
Signed-off-by: NIIBE Yutaka
--
Diffstat (limited to 'g10/mainproc.c')
0 files changed, 0 insertions, 0 deletions
